What is the difference between an IATA code and an ICAO code?

IATA codes are the 3-letter codes used on tickets and boarding passes (e.g. CAN for Guangzhou Baiyun); ICAO codes are 4-letter codes used in flight operations (e.g. ZGGG). Both appear on travel documents and are preserved, not translated, in certified translations.
